Output e76fc78ca2be13a1899459a229a7d5d5f28f51e820e94db25c17df308d282b60:6

value
9840151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98024bb3d19f9a7bce0673c70226cfba904ecd72 OP_EQUAL
address
3FYmPDBfVn5rcDj8tjkdwcgsHRxKUCS1BE
transaction
e76fc78ca2be13a1899459a229a7d5d5f28f51e820e94db25c17df308d282b60
spent
true